Cancer preventive agents, Part 2: Synthesis and evaluation of 2-phenyl-4-quinolone and 9-oxo-9,10-dihydroacridine derivatives as novel antitumor promoters
Authors:Nakamura Seikou  Kozuka Mutsuo  Bastow Kenneth F  Tokuda Harukuni  Nishino Hoyoku  Suzuki Madoka  Tatsuzaki Jin  Morris Natschke Susan L  Kuo Sheng-Chu  Lee Kuo-Hsiung
Institution:Natural Products Laboratory, School of Pharmacy, University of North Carolina, Chapel Hill, NC 27599, USA.
Abstract:2-Phenyl-4-quinolone and 9-oxo-9,10-dihydroacridine derivatives were synthesized and screened as potential antitumor promoters by examining the ability of the compounds to inhibit Epstein-Barr virus early antigen (EBV-EA) activation induced by the tumor promoter 12-O-tetradecanoylphorbol-13-acetate (TPA) in Raji cells. Interestingly, compounds 14, 15, and 17 showed similar inhibitory effects (89-92%, 66-69%, and 24-29% at 1000, 500, and 100 mol ratio to TPA, respectively) against EBV-EA with potencies comparable to those of glycyrrhetic acid, a known natural antitumor-promoter.
